Job Title: RN - Labor & Delivery; PRN
Supervised by: Nurse Manager
Demonstrates Competency in the Following Areas:
- Able to assess neonate at delivery and perform neonatal resuscitation according to AHA/AAP guidelines. Ability to conduct antepartum, intrapartum and postpartum assessments.
- Demonstrates knowledge of fetal monitoring. Identifies FHR patterns and treats appropriately.
- Ability to assess presenting part by Leopold Maneuver and/or digital exam.
- Ability to assess fetal cardiac activity with ultrasound transducer and contraction activity with Toco transducer.

Regulatory Requirements
- Successful completion of Neonatal Resuscitation Certification and Basic to Intermediate fetal monitoring course.
- Graduate of an accredited school of nursing.
- Current state Registered Nurse Licensure, within state of practice.
- Current BLS certification.

- This position is a safety sensitive position pursuant to Amendment 98 to the Arkansas Constitution § 2(25). A safety sensitive position means any position in which a person performing the position while under the influence of marijuana may constitute a threat to health or safety. This position is therefore “safety sensitive” due to the fact it requires the following: performing life-threatening procedures; working with hazardous or flammable materials, controlled substances, food, or medicine; and a lapse of attention while working in this position could result in injury, illness, or death.
